The Role
As Site Engineer, you will be responsible for ensuring the accurate delivery of civil engineering projects, providing technical support, and coordinating site activities. You will work closely with site teams, project managers, and clients to ensure projects are delivered safely, on time, and to the highest standards.
Responsibilities
* Assisting with the preparation of tenders and project documentation
* Liaising with clients, statutory bodies, and other stakeholders
* Setting out site works and preparing “as-built” drawings for awarded contracts
* Supervising site activities, issuing job instructions, and leading toolbox talks
* Conducting regular site visits to monitor progress and quality
* Supporting QHSE compliance, assessing risks, and producing RAMS as required
* Assisting with material requisitions and project resources
* Supporting the Contracts Manager and Quantity Surveyor with project measurements and valuations
* Operating internal management systems (IMS)
* Managing minor employee issues within your team and escalating as required
